What is the Medication Preparation Reconstitution Checklist?
The Medication Preparation Reconstitution Checklist serves as a crucial tool in healthcare settings, designed to ensure the safe and effective preparation of medications. This checklist defines the specific steps required for proper medication reconstitution, making it essential for candidates being evaluated on their medication preparation skills.
Utilizing this checklist plays a vital role in enhancing medication safety and adherence to established procedures, ultimately protecting patient well-being. By providing a standardized approach, it helps both candidates and examiners maintain high standards in medication handling.
